Del Monte tomato paste 70g Del Monte tomato paste 70g
70
g
Del Monte tomato paste 70g Del Monte tomato paste 70g
70
g

Del Monte tomato paste 70g

Productsheets

The products of Jack Klijn

Want to work together? Get in touch.